Transaction 63ee3720a2c7bf4112f4dac9ddb89eeab950011d6aca0eedfce74531bc104f31

1 Input
2 Outputs
  • 63ee3720a2c7bf4112f4dac9ddb89eeab950011d6aca0eedfce74531bc104f31:0
  • value  2726714
    address  185cP6mQbqzhN75ojwR28tjFJ3iW9gR85N
  • 63ee3720a2c7bf4112f4dac9ddb89eeab950011d6aca0eedfce74531bc104f31:1
  • value  96513903
    address  1Pmry4yeC3A5YmTSfEiXnUfBL6Egj32E2D